One Inc to collaborate with SECURA Insurance!

- Advertisement -

California, USA (CU)_ According to the latest announcement from One Inc, the top digital payments portal for the insurance industry, SECURA Insurance based in Wisconsin has chosen One Inc’s full suite of best-in-class digital payment solutions PremiumPay® and ClaimsPay®, for both inbound and outbound payments for one of its insurance products.

As a result, inbound client payments are handled seamlessly, and claims are disbursed and closed more quickly, enabling SECURA to better service their customers’ demands and decrease operating expenses. As the carrier gradually develops its digital payment experience, SECURA aims to install and integrate One Inc’s suite of digital payments for a single product line.

SECURA has been committed to meeting the requirements and expectations of its policy holders and independent agents for more than a century by providing exceptional products and unparalleled customer service. SECURA is a regional group of property-casualty insurance firms based in Neenah, WI, and functioning in 13 states, with over 550 independent insurance agents working for the group. The organization offers a wide selection of competitive commercial, agricultural, personal, farm, nonprofit, and special events products.

According to Mary Gronbach, Director of Finance & Investments at SECURA, “Since its inception, SECURA’s focus has always been about the value of personal relationships, providing peace of mind and protection to our customers, and today, those priorities extend to the way we manage payment touch points. One Inc understands this evolution, and we are confident this first step of our partnership will pave the way for future growth in our digital payments.”

Ian Drysdale, Chief Executive Officer at One Inc, expressed excitement over the partnership. He said, “We’re excited SECURA is making an investment towards digital transformation using One Inc’s full suite of products. By leveraging our network this way, SECURA will be able to drive payments efficiencies and fluidly adapt to new technology, two crucial elements needed to meet and exceed the needs of their customers and stay competitive.”
